The population of Pukwana, SD in 2022 is estimated to be 223. This is a decrease of -2.19% (-5 people) compared to the population in 2021.

The most common language spoken in Pukwana is English, with 99.41% of people speaking Only English. In addition, 0.59% of people speak Other Languages, coming in second.
